What actually breaks
Exceptions run the day
The plan is fine until 06:00. Delays, failed handovers and missing scans get handled by phone and heroics.
— Exceptions surface after the customer notices— Escalation is tribal knowledge— Root causes never aggregate— The same failure repeats next week
SLA truth arrives too late
Performance against SLAs is computed after the month closes — too late to act on any of it.
— Penalties discovered at invoicing— No live view per lane or customer— Disputes argued without shared data— Improvement projects fly blind
Depot, fleet and forecast don't share a screen
Planning, execution and customer service each watch a different system and reconcile by meeting.
— Re-keying between TMS, WMS and CRM— Customer service can't see operations— Capacity decisions on stale data— Integration projects that never end
Partner networks on email
Carriers, linehaul partners and last-mile subcontractors: onboarding, rates, claims and performance all live in threads.
— Onboarding takes weeks— Claims drag for months— Rate cards in spreadsheets— Performance reviews without data
